Python实现工作簿工作表批量重命名技巧
需积分: 0 168 浏览量
更新于2024-11-25
收藏 644B RAR 举报
资源摘要信息:"本资源提供了使用Python脚本批量重命名Excel工作簿中所有工作表的方法。通过下载并解压相关文件,用户可以获得一个Python脚本,该脚本利用Python的xlwings库来实现与Excel的交互。xlwings是一个允许Python代码与Excel应用程序进行交互的库,它可以读取、修改Excel文件中的内容,包括工作表的名称。本脚本的使用场景适用于需要对大量Excel工作簿中的工作表进行统一命名规则调整的情况,能够大大节省手工重命名的时间。使用该脚本前,用户需要确保已安装Python环境以及xlwings库。脚本的具体使用方法和可配置的参数将在解压后的文档或代码注释中详细说明。"
知识点详细说明:
1. Python编程语言基础: Python是一种高级编程语言,以其简洁明了的语法和强大的功能而闻名,非常适合数据处理和自动化任务。在本资源中,Python被用来编写自动化脚本,实现批量重命名工作簿中的工作表。
2. xlwings库使用: xlwings是一个开源的库,用于Python与Excel之间的交互。它可以用来读取、创建、修改和写入Excel文件,包括工作表、单元格内容、图表等。在本资源中,xlwings用于实现Python脚本与Excel文件的连接,以及执行重命名工作表的操作。
3. 批量重命名的实现: 资源中的Python脚本会读取Excel工作簿,并遍历工作簿中的所有工作表。脚本可能包含一个预先定义的命名规则或允许用户输入自定义规则,然后根据规则批量修改工作表的名称。这通常涉及到循环结构和条件判断语句。
4. Excel工作簿与工作表概念: 在Excel中,工作簿(Workbook)可以看作是一个电子表格文件,里面可以包含多个工作表(Worksheet)。每个工作表包含了特定类型的数据和信息,可以独立命名。
5. 自动化与效率提升: 通过编写自动化脚本,可以显著提高处理重复性任务的效率。在本资源的应用场景中,相比手动打开每个工作簿并重命名每个工作表,使用Python脚本可以在几秒钟内完成批量操作,这对于处理包含大量工作表的Excel文件尤其有用。
6. 脚本环境配置: 用户在使用该脚本前需要具备Python的运行环境,并且需要安装xlwings库。在Python环境中,可以通过pip命令安装xlwings库。安装命令通常为:`pip install xlwings`。
7. 脚本使用方法: 解压资源后,用户应该阅读脚本内的注释或相关文档来了解如何正确使用脚本。这可能包括输入工作簿路径、指定命名规则以及执行脚本的步骤。
8. 错误处理: 在脚本的开发过程中,开发者通常会考虑到错误处理,比如检查工作簿是否存在、工作表是否可以重命名等。资源中的Python脚本可能包含必要的错误处理代码来确保在遇到问题时能够给出清晰的错误提示,使得用户能够快速定位问题并解决。
9. 用户交互设计: 如果脚本设计得当,它还可能允许用户通过命令行界面或图形用户界面进行交互,让用户选择工作簿、设置重命名规则,并控制脚本执行的其他细节。
通过上述知识点的介绍,可以了解到本资源不仅提供了实现批量重命名工作表的Python脚本,还涉及到了Python基础编程、xlwings库应用、Excel文件结构、自动化提高效率、脚本配置及错误处理等多个方面的知识点。这些知识点对于希望提高Excel数据处理效率的用户来说,都是非常有价值的信息。
2024-03-14 上传
2023-03-10 上传
2024-10-26 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
2024-10-26 上传
2023-02-20 上传
2023-02-20 上传
Dilraba。
- 粉丝: 0
- 资源: 101
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器